Selenium自动化环境配置 1. 在 https://mvnrepository.com/ 搜索selenium-java,复制需要的selenium包的依赖,      放入IDEA的pom文
## 如何实现“python火狐浏览器驱动下载” 作为一名经验丰富的开发者,我将教会你如何使用Python下载火狐浏览器驱动。下面,我将分步骤介绍整个过程,并提供相应的代码和注释。 ### 步骤概览 下表展示了实现“Python火狐浏览器驱动下载”的步骤概览: | 步骤 | 动作 | | --- | --- | | 步骤一 | 检查浏览器版本 | | 步骤二 | 下载对应的驱动 | | 步
# 如何实现Python Selenium 火狐浏览器驱动下载 ## 整体流程 首先,我们需要下载geckodriver,它是Selenium用于控制Firefox浏览器的驱动程序。然后,将geckodriver添加到系统路径中,以便Selenium能够找到它。最后,通过Selenium启动Firefox浏览器并进行测试。 以下是整个过程的步骤: | 步骤 | 操作 | | ------ |
卸载火狐 若用centos,fedora,rhel,等,可用:yum remove firefox,若是ubuntu,则,输入:apt-get remove firefox一: 安装火狐命令 yum -y install firefox二:浏览器显示中文 yum install fonts-chinese yum install fonts-ISO8859-2-75dpi修改 /etc/sysco
转载 2023-07-11 10:53:37
126阅读
selenium是thoughtworks公司开发的一款开源的测试工具,主要用来做web端的自动化测试。Python安装selenium,直接使用执行pip install selenium(python)命令安装即可,默认安装的是最新的,也就是selenium的3.x版本,以前selenium2.x版本的时候,是自带了Firefox的驱动,直接可以打开火狐浏览器的,现在3.x版本,打开火狐也需要
下载地址链接 密码:sxbs一:先说谷歌插件吧,坑少。 目前,Chrome官方已经禁止非Chrome商店的应用安装了,下面说下CRX格式安装方法-Chrome插件离线安装。1.找到XPath Helper Wizard.crx文件。2.在谷歌地址栏输入:chrome://extensions/回车,即可打开扩展程序管理。3.将XPath Helper Wizard.crx拖入扩展程序界面
selenium是一个用于web应用程序测试的工具,Selenium测试直接运行在浏览器中,就像真正的用户在操作一样。支持的浏览器包括IE、Mozilla Firefox、Mozilla Suite等。这个工具的主要功能包括:测试与浏览器的兼容性——测试你的应用程序看是否能够很好得工作在不同浏览器和操作系统之上。测试系统功能——创建衰退测试检验软件功能和用户需求。支持自动录制动作和自动生成。Net
转载 7月前
135阅读
# Python 启动火狐驱动 ![state diagram](img/state_diagram.png) ## 简介 在使用 Python 进行 web 自动化测试时,我们经常需要启动浏览器,并与其进行交互。本文将介绍如何使用 Python 启动火狐浏览器的驱动,并通过代码示例演示其用法。 ## 火狐驱动的安装 要启动火狐浏览器的驱动,我们需要安装 `geckodriver`。`
原创 10月前
178阅读
因有工作中有自动化的需求,开始尝试用python 和selenium 写个基于web的脚步。初步搭建环境,pycharm 安装selenium,默认安装了3.14的版本。本机Firefox的版本为最新(68),且安装了geckodriver v0.24.0(Firefox的驱动包,使用selenium需要的)。环境ok后,就开始在pycharm中编写基本的脚本,编写了几倍呢的脚步后,运行ok。开始
转载 8月前
545阅读
前言目前selenium版本已经升级到3.0了,网上的大部分教程是基于2.0写的,所以在学习前先要弄清楚版本号,这点非常重要。本系列依然以selenium2为基础,目前selenium3坑比较多,暂时没精力去研究,后续会出相关教程。一、selenium简介Selenium 是用于测试 Web 应用程序用户界面 (UI) 的常用框架。它是一款用于运行端到端功能测试的超强工具。您可以使用多个编程语言编
火狐浏览器Firefox历史版本官方下载地址:https://ftp.mozilla.org/pub/firefox/releases/或者通过如下链接下载:https://download.mozilla.org/?product=firefox-17.0&os=linux&lang=zh-CNproduct参数为火狐版本号:firefox-17.0为17.0版本,firefox
前言: 1.本文为个人开发笔记,其他阅读者需熟悉JAVA且对HTML有基本的认识 2.为什么我选择火狐?因为chrome需要下载对应版本的驱动我用的浏览器版本比较新,一直没找到匹配的驱动,所以选择了火狐火狐就到官网下载一个最新版的就行(我是这样)。准备: 1.火狐下载地址(建议安装在默认地址,emm只是建议)2.以下地址三选一github驱动下载地址(往下面滚动一下,下载对应OS版本,我是win
# 火狐Python Selenium指定驱动路径的完整指南 在自动化测试和网页数据抓取中,Selenium被广泛应用。使用Selenium时,我们需要指定相应的驱动程序来与浏览器进行交互。在这篇文章中,我们将聚焦于如何在Python中使用Selenium与火狐浏览器进行自动化测试,并指定驱动路径。 ## 1. 环境准备 在开始之前,你需要确保已经安装了以下工具: - Python:确保你
原创 11天前
35阅读
# Java 火狐浏览器驱动 在进行自动化测试时,我们经常会使用不同的浏览器驱动来控制浏览器进行测试操作。在这篇文章中,我们将重点介绍如何在 Java 项目中使用火狐浏览器的驱动来进行自动化测试。 ## 火狐浏览器驱动 火狐浏览器的驱动叫做 GeckoDriver,是一个基于 W3C WebDriver 协议的驱动程序,用于控制火狐浏览器进行自动化测试。GeckoDriver 是一个独立的可
一、安装seleniumWindows命令行(cmd)输入pip install selenium(无须指定版本默认最新)或 pip install selenium==3.141.0(可指定版本) 即可自动安装selenium。安装完成后,输入pip show selenium 或 pip list  可查看当前的selenium版本,参考下图。  二、安
转载 2023-08-29 17:56:23
2695阅读
火狐浏览器下掉了firebug和firepath插件,用户即使下载火狐55以下的版本,也无法查找到这两个插件。可以用以下方法来获取这两个插件。第1步:下载火狐55以内版本安装包,安装时迅速设置禁止自动更新版本,取消勾选自动更新(和之前一样)54版本火狐浏览器的下载地址:64位火狐54:://ftp.mozilla.org/pub/firefox/releases/54.0.1/win64
在selenium2中启动常见的火狐、chrome其实都比较简单,网上也一堆教程。现在selenium最新版已经是 3.x的版本了,与selenium2其实没有太大的区别,无非就是精简了一些不用的东西,然后对于浏览器的支持更好了,比如,对于高版本的firefox、chrome、edge等都可以完美支持,这样我们就不用受限于版本的问题了。 但很多童鞋在用selenium3启动浏览器的时候都
转载 10月前
485阅读
本篇内容基于Win10 64位、Python3.7版本,FireFox版本为最新版65.0,不同版本表现可能有所不同。使用webdriver的过程中,碰到了几个问题,网上找到的一些步骤和说明感觉不够清晰,因此这里记录一下,供大家参考。 目录一、多版本Python切换二、安装Selenium1. 使用pip安装2. 使用Pycharm安装三、配置FireFox1. 添加FireFox驱动2
一. 需要用到的模块  from selenium import webdriver  # 用于操控浏览器  from PIL import Image  # 用于图片截取,修改. 模块安装方法pip install pillow  import pytesseract  # 用于识别验证码  import bs4  # 主要用其中的bs4.Beautifu
1、安装火狐浏览器这里安装其他浏览器也可以,主要是要安装Tampermonkey插件。safari浏览器该插件收费12元,谷歌需要科学上网才能下载插件。除了火狐也可以选择edge。2、浏览器安装Tampermonkey插件地址:https://www.tampermonkey.net/?ext=dhdg 直接下载安装即可。3、安装aria2没有安装homebrew的需要先安装一下homebrew。
  • 1
  • 2
  • 3
  • 4
  • 5